US Material Events SEC 8-K Filings — June 10, 2026
The 50 filings from June 10, 2026, reveal a market dominated by significant capital markets activity, including major debt and equity offerings, and a wave of de-SPAC transactions and strategic M&A. Key period-over-period trends show a biotech sector actively raising capital to extend runways, with companies like Tango Therapeutics ($566.5M) and Syndax ($250M) securing substantial funding. Insider activity is mixed, with several CFO and board appointments signaling strategic pivots, while the departure of a COO at DeFi Development Corp. and a CMO at LB Pharmaceuticals create near-term uncertainty. Capital allocation trends are bifurcated: some firms like RadNet are adding debt for growth, while others like Hut 8 are taking on high-yield notes for large-scale projects. The most critical developments include the $1.35B de-SPAC of Einride, the $4.25B data center financing by Hut 8, and the $437.5M hotel sale by Braemar, all pointing to a market actively reallocating capital into high-growth infrastructure and real estate. Portfolio-level patterns indicate a strong push into AI and HPC-related infrastructure, alongside a cautious but active biotech funding environment.
